I just took one of the screws from the existing clutch reservoir cover to a local fastener store and asked for a couple of screws with the same pitch but a little longer. I kind of guesstimated what I needed, so I can't tell you the exact size, but screws are dirt cheap, so you could get a few lengths and try them out. The critical part is to make sure the thread pitch is compatible. The mount works like a charm.:thumbup:
